    Smart Speech Recognition Application for Quran Recitation
    (Library Information Services, CUI Lahore, 2023) Khawaja Ali Hassan; SP18-BSE-080; Dr. Atifa Athar
    Around the world total population of Muslims is 1.8 billion and out of this approximately 422 million people can speak Arabic language. Therefore, only 20% of Muslims can understand the Arabic language and 80% of Muslims can’t understand the Arabic language. Arabic is the fifth most spoken language in the world. The Quran is the most precious thing for Muslims. The Quran is revelation from God. So, getting to know the actual meaning of the Quran is essential. Most of the Muslims can’t understand what is being said while reading or hearing the Quran recitation. Based on this, we need to develop an application that can visually show the translation of Quran verses in multiple languages whenever it has been recited in real time. Our core idea is to show textual data (Quran verse with translation) on application

    Voli- The Artificial Therapist
    (Library Information Services, CUI Lahore, 2021) Muhammad Saad; LHR TP 7512; FA17- BCS-004; Dr. Atifa Athar
    Humans tend to face several issues concerning their emotions in society. Such issues with dealing with their emotions may stop them from reaching out to a therapist. Psychologists use several methods to resolve emotional conflicts faced by patients with mental issues including cognitive psychotherapy. Cognitive understanding plays a huge role in the betterment of the emotional competence of a patient. Henceforth, there is a requirement of such an agent that may play the role of a helping- hand to the human therapist in this task by aiding them in getting an idea of the emotions of the human patient. Therefore, a combination of different areas of research and development; Psychology, Artificial Intelligence, Game Design, and Game Development is required to model the interaction between a human and an artificial agent through the means of a video game and a textual conversation that represent classified emotions per a proposed model. Such an agent is required to observe the emotions of the player based on the decisions made and then work as a one-way conversational artificial bot to ask certain pre-selected questions that help the bot guess the emotions of the player. Upon the basis of such a sentiment analysis, the model responds by providing media-oriented recommendations to the player

    Interactive Student Academic Counsellor (ISAC)
    (Library Information Services, COMSATS University Islamabad, Lahore Campus., 2020-11-20) Maleeha Qureshi; FA16-BCS-201; Dr. Atifa Athar; LHR TP 6202
    This report describes the project proceedings and the background knowledge of Artificial Intelligence that shall be utilized throughout the making of the project. The project is based on designing an intelligent agent (ISAC) that will assist the students in matters related to student services provided on campus. This agent will carry out time-consuming academic tasks that as it would need to evaluate the cases of all students to specify certain choices. It will be able to facilitate students according to the policy of the institution. The current manual system of registering, adding, dropping, withdrawal of courses is outdated nowadays and it has also put mental stress on students. The current system lacks student counseling and advising rendering it difficult and frustrating for students to perform efficiently in their academics. A lot of helpful assistance can be taken by artificial intelligence. Intelligent agents are designed today to help humans in their daily problems. These agents are efficient as they assist humans in minimizing their workload. Robots (Hanson robotics Sophia, Mayfield robotics Kuri), Chatbots (Tutor, Mitsuku, and Uberbot), virtual agents (Amelia, Siri), and softbots have provided assistance to human in their work.

    Robot Navigation using Situation Awareness
    (Library Information Services, COMSATS University Islamabad, Lahore Campus., 2020-11-20) H.M Suleman Khan; FA16-BCS-055; Dr. Atifa Athar; LHR TP 6203
    In the presence of efficient ongoing changes that are being brought in industry, the concept of automation is becoming a well-known factor in robots. The main focus of this project would be to let the robot navigate in a dynamic industrial environment and for it to reach the desired target. This project includes that if any blocking situation occurs during navigation, the robot will reach the target by using an alternate path. As the robot may experience an obstacle during navigation, it would use the concept of situation awareness to define its required path for reaching the target. The robot will also be responsible for solving any unwanted event that may occur during its navigation towards the target location.
